技术文摘
Vue 基础到实践入门指引
Vue 基础到实践入门指引
在当今前端开发领域,Vue 框架以其简洁、高效和灵活的特点备受开发者青睐。对于初学者来说,从 Vue 的基础知识到实践应用的跨越可能会感到有些困惑。本文将为您提供一份 Vue 基础到实践的入门指引,帮助您顺利踏上 Vue 开发之旅。
让我们来了解 Vue 的核心概念。Vue 采用了组件化的开发模式,将页面拆分成一个个独立的可复用组件。每个组件都有自己的模板、逻辑和样式,这使得代码的组织和维护更加清晰和高效。
Vue 的模板语法简洁易懂,通过双花括号{{ }}来进行数据绑定,让页面能够实时反映数据的变化。例如,<div>{{ message }}</div>,当message变量的值发生改变时,页面中的对应内容也会自动更新。
接下来是 Vue 的指令,如v-if、v-for等。v-if用于条件渲染,根据条件决定元素是否显示;v-for用于遍历数组或对象,动态生成多个元素。
掌握了基本语法后,就可以开始构建一个简单的 Vue 应用了。首先创建一个 HTML 文件,引入 Vue 库。然后在<script>标签中定义 Vue 实例,设置数据、方法等。
在实践中,还需要学会处理组件之间的通信。父组件向子组件传递数据可以通过属性,子组件向父组件通信可以通过事件。
Vue 还提供了丰富的路由和状态管理方案,如 Vue Router 和 Vuex,帮助我们构建复杂的单页应用。
在学习 Vue 的过程中,要多动手实践,通过实际项目来加深对知识的理解和掌握。可以从模仿一些简单的示例开始,逐渐尝试自己开发功能完整的应用。
利用好 Vue 的官方文档和社区资源也是非常重要的。遇到问题时,在社区中往往能找到解决方案和灵感。
Vue 为前端开发带来了全新的体验和高效的开发方式。通过掌握基础知识,并不断在实践中积累经验,您将能够轻松驾驭 Vue,开发出优秀的前端应用。愿您在 Vue 的世界中畅游,创造出更多精彩的作品!
- BigDecimal 不丢失精度的原因
- 11 个提升 PyTorch 性能的 GPU 编程技巧
- 19 个 Python 函数参数设计高级指南
- 十分钟轻松掌握进程、线程与协程
- 2024 年五大前沿 CSS 功能 | 高级 CSS 技术
- 前端代码注释的神奇小技巧,令领导欣喜若狂!
- 前端调试新奇法,竟然如此操作!
- 新一代前端框架 Svelte 走红!十个场景轻松了解它!
- Git Worktree 助您告别分支切换!
- 2024 年五大前沿 CSS 功能
- Go 语言泛型的详细使用
- 微服务数量激增:过多微服务带来不必要负担
- .NET 借助 Moq 开源模拟库优化单元测试
- ThreadLocal 源码剖析:初探 ThreadLocal
- 亿级流量下分布式限流的实现:必备理论解析